One of the best care homes in Kincardineshire, Mowat Court Care Home offers a personalised approach to residential, dementia, nursing, respite and end-of-life care. Rated 'Very Good' by the Care Inspectorate, the home boasts 46 en-suite bedrooms, cosy communal lounges, and a hair and beauty salon. Residents enjoy a variety of activities, from gardening to quiz nights, organised by dedicated activity coordinators. With a location surrounded by local shops and amenities, your loved one will find a true home-from-home here

Nestled in the scenic Kincardineshire harbour town of Stonehaven, Havencourt Care Home provides exceptional residential, dementia, and nursing care for up to 42 residents. Each en-suite bedroom features television and phone points, ensuring comfort and convenience. Rated 'Good' by the Care Inspectorate, Havencourt offers a packed schedule of activities and regular day trips, fostering a vibrant community atmosphere. With excellent transport links and a variety of local amenities, Havencourt ensures your loved one receives quality care and companionship

Burnside Care Home offers expert residential, nursing, dementia, respite, and convalescent care. With a 'Good' rating from the Care Inspectorate, the home features 57 en-suite rooms, homely lounges, and beautiful outdoor spaces. The dedicated team of nurses and activity coordinators work tirelessly to make each day engaging and enjoyable for residents. Close to local shops and public transport, Burnside Care Home provides a supportive and enriching setting for your loved ones
